The story follows , a teenager from the United States with a passion for soccer. Her dream comes true when she is accepted into a prestigious soccer camp in Mazatlán, México . However, her excitement quickly turns to fear as she begins to experience eerie events at night, including spine-chilling cries that no one else seems to hear. la llorona de mazatlan pdf

The legend of La Llorona de Mazatlán has been interpreted in various ways by scholars and psychologists. Some see her as a symbol of the destructive power of unchecked emotions, while others view her as a representation of the oppression and marginalization of women in Mexican society. According to legend, La Llorona de Mazatlán appears to travelers and locals alike, usually near bodies of water, dressed in a long, white gown, her face deathly pale, and her eyes black as coal. Her presence is often accompanied by an unearthly weeping sound, which is said to be so haunting that it can curdle milk and freeze the blood of those who hear it.
